Merchandise Planner - Deli jobs in the United States

Merchandise Planner - Deli develops strategies and techniques to increase sales of deli meats and other products. Analyzes department profits and profit margins of individual items. Being a Merchandise Planner - Deli controls ordering, inventory, and quality of deli products. Responsible for increasing business with new and existing customers. Additionally, Merchandise Planner - Deli may require a bachelor's degree in area of specialty. Typically reports to a supervisor or manager. To be a Merchandise Planner - Deli typically requires 2 to 4 years of related experience. Gains exposure to some of the complex tasks within the job function. Occasionally directed in several aspects of the work.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

    Job Summary:

    The Merchandise Planner will own the role of developing, executing, and communicating merchandise financial plans & forecasts and strategies that support the category merchandising, marketing, and financial objectives across several channels of distribution. You are responsible for analyzing historical trends to influence pre-season forecasts while simultaneously hitting in-season financial sales, margin, and inventory targets. Comfort with reporting and recapping without prejudice the facts and needs to address based on will be critical in this role. This is an analytical job-we need someone who is detail oriented and excellent with managing and owning data . They will need to prepare and report data in informational ways with observations, conclusions and recommend or take actions with inventory. This role is highly influential across the organization and must work well with others in-directly.

    What you will do:

    • Drive financial results that maximize sales, manage effectively inventory, and optimize profitability across multiple channels of distribution
    • Create pre-season plans/ forecasts and manage in-season sales forecasts and inventory across multiple channels of distribution
    • Build plans that are secure but align to top line annual commercial growth strategies
    • Analyze historical data and current trends to identify risks and opportunities by category of business and in some cases by item
    • Assist in execution of forecasting/planning system roll out
    • Create and report Selling (Sell In for Wholesale / Sell Out for DTC) Weekly Monthly Seasonally
    • Will create seasonal product productivity and effectiveness analysis to present assortment planning recommendation. Drops / Adds / Expand
    • Will do price elasticity and competitive pricing analysis to support merchandising team and sales team on seasonal price plans
    • Process, predict and analyze product demand including specific factors relating to product promotions, creative promotions, and seasonality
    • Seek solutions to business obstacles and process opportunities
    • Be nimble and fast with data analysis and updating plans and forecasts to impact trends. Mainly positive trends to maximize sales and optimize margins but negatively too for effective inventory management
    • Inventory quality manager. Freshness, end of season levels of expiring products,
    • Lifecycle planning
    • Owns OTB/Inventory governance
    • Plans inventory and TOS. “Turn Over Speed”

    How you will do it:

    • Collaborate with all departments to develop pre-season strategies that align with future financial and product opportunities
    • Work across the organization to ensure timely and accurate execution of in-season product strategies
    • Develop knowledge of new reporting systems, planning tools, and multiple distribution channels
    • Through sophisticated analysis skills. Build analysis’, Break even analysis’s (i.e. Price & Promotion vs margin $ & %)
    • Manage inventory and constantly strive for improved productivity
